What you need:
Canvas
Box of crayons
blow-dryer
Glue gun
some kind of drop cloth to catch any splatters
1. Simply arrange your crayons on the canvas with hot-glue
2. Blow-dry away! It'll take a few seconds to get the crayons heated up to melt
3. Watch your crayons melt away!
This is one neat project! Enjoy!
